Harvard University - Cambridge, Massachusetts

Harvard University's Environmental Science & Engineering concentration, housed in the School of Engineering and Applied Sciences, combines engineering, natural sciences, and mathematics. This empowers students to address environmental challenges effectively. Students can pursue either a Bachelor of Arts (BA) or a Bachelor of Science (BS) degree. The BA option offers more flexibility to incorporate courses from outside engineering, while the BS degree is an engineering-intensive course of study.

Columbia University - New York, New York

Columbia University's Earth and Environmental Engineering program trains engineers to provide leadership and innovation in the responsible use of Earth's resources. Students in the program focus on one of three problem areas during their third and fourth years: Water Resources and Climate Risks, Sustainable Energy and Materials, or Environmental Health Engineering. This focused approach guides their experiences and helps them find internships, research opportunities, and career paths.

Yale University - New Haven, Connecticut

Yale University offers two paths to majoring in Environmental Engineering: a BS in Environmental Engineering and a BA in Engineering Sciences (Environmental). The BS is tailored for students seeking a strong engineering background for careers as engineers. The BA is designed for students interested in careers that benefit from an engineering foundation but do not involve practicing engineering, such as law, medicine, or public service. Both options have significant math requirements prior to declaring the major.

University of Michigan - Ann Arbor, Michigan

The Environmental Engineering degree at the University of Michigan's College of Engineering challenges students to become engineers in service to society. Students work towards solutions for cleaner water, land, and air, as well as alternative energy options, through a four-year program or a five-year bachelors/masters combination called the Sequential Undergraduate/Graduate Studies Program (SUGS). Notably, over 50% of the students in this major identify as female, demonstrating gender parity in a collegiate engineering program.

Northeastern University - Boston, Massachusetts

Northeastern University's Environmental Engineering major emphasizes innovation, design, and transformative change. Students address significant global challenges through an engineering lens. Through courses like “Engineering Microbiology and Ecology” and “Environmental Pollution Fate and Transport,” along with the immersive co-op experiential learning program, students develop conceptual knowledge and hands-on expertise.

Drexel University - Philadelphia, Pennsylvania

Drexel University's BS in Environmental Engineering is distinguished by its co-op program. Like Northeastern, Drexel requires students to participate in the workforce while pursuing their degree. This allows students to apply their learning in real-world settings and discover new passions. Students can graduate in four years with one six-month co-op or in five years with three co-ops.

Syracuse University - Syracuse, New York

Syracuse University offers a five-year program that combines a bachelor’s and master’s degree. While not required for majoring in environmental engineering, this program is an excellent option for students looking to enter the engineering field directly after college. Students focus on the preservation and management of the environment and can collaborate with faculty on research projects and find employment in fieldwork and paid summer internships.

University of California Davis - Davis, California

Students at UC Davis speak highly of the environmental engineering program. They learn and develop tangible ways to address complex challenges. There is also an option to double major in Civil Engineering and Environmental Engineering, a combination highly valued in the workforce.
